PbAl3(PO4)(PO3OH)(OH)6
Powder blue colored Plumbogummite has partially replaced lime green colored Pyromorphite. The Plumbogummite has a very interesting skeletal structure. Many of the crystals retain a core of Pyromorphite. The Plumbogummite fluoresces bright green under SW UV and less so under LW (the photos were done under SW).
Condition: Good
Flaws: The Plumbogummite is missing in places revealing the Pyromorphite core; most of this is not damage but natural.
